306 auto gearbox probs

I have an annoying problem. when my auto 306 is cold it suddenly jumps into
diff lock and sport mode..the lights on the dash come on. I stop the car and
turn the ign off and on and the problem goes. when the car is warm there is
no probs.
any suggestions would be greatly appreciated

Mick,

I have an almost identical problem with a 406.
Happened a couple of times on Sunday and was fine when restarted. I've had
it in to Peugeot cos it was going in for service anyway and, surprise
surprise, they can find nothing wrong. But, they can find nothing right!
No communication from the engine ECU to the gearbox ECU. And such is the
quality of peugeot techies that if the laptop doesn't give them the
answer, they're stumped. Basically the gearbox and ecu are functioning
fine but may not forever. I have the part number from peaugeot for a
replacement gearbox ECU (?650 +vat) and they want me to order it to see if
that's the problem. OK then... They did say that pettern ECUs exist, but I
can't find them. Does anybody know where I could get a recon ECU for a
gearbox? Please keep me updated on your problem, as we speak my car is
running fine.

Your best bet is a breaker's yard or send your ECU to an independent
specialist to see if it is faulty. Personally I doubt the ECU is at
fault. It seems too often engineers blame everything on a faulty ECU.

Garages don't like spending much time trying to figure out faults like
this because they know they can only charge so much. They make far more
just doing bread and butter stamped servicing.
